GREENSLADE Taylor Hunt report another buoyant machinery trade at their sale on Friday, September 1, where livestock farmers and machinery traders alike turned out in their droves.

The dispersal was conducted on behalf of the Symes Partners at Wellspring Farm, Misterton, Crewkerne, Somerset. The tractor line contained the highest prices of the day, topping at £11,000 for a 2004 McCormick CX95 complete with a Quicke loader. An ever-popular 2012 John Deere Gator 885 sold for £5,900, which was closely followed by a Ford 3930, which sold for £5,400.

Amongst the farm machinery on offer were a number of impressive items, of which a 22’ Portequip bale trailer led the way and achieved £3,500. Other prices of note included a Richard Western grain trailer selling for £3,400, a Teagle Titan 70 silage trailer selling for £3,300 and also a Taarup 3128 mower conditioner realised £2,850.
